Fernando Alonso’s Future at Aston Martin: Shocking Revelations Unveiled!

Could Fernando Alonso’s F1 journey extend beyond expectations at Aston Martin? Rumors suggest a possible contract extension with the team, surpassing his current deal set to end in 2026. Despite a rocky start to the 2025 season with disappointing finishes in the Australian and Chinese Grands Prix, Alonso’s future in the sport might be far from over, as hinted by Ralf Schumacher.

The Formula 1 world is abuzz with speculations as Schumacher hinted at Alonso potentially staying with Aston Martin post his driving career, possibly in an advisory capacity. The team’s recent moves, including securing design guru Adrian Newey and upgrading their wind tunnel facilities, hint at a strategic focus on the upcoming regulation changes for next year’s championship battle.

Schumacher drew parallels with the iconic 2009 season when Brawn GP, under Ross Brawn’s leadership, stunned the world by clinching both drivers’ and constructors’ championships in their debut year. With Aston Martin’s current trajectory and the expertise of Newey, could 2026 be a milestone year for Alonso and the team?
